FAQs: Travel from Dublin to Liverpool

Travel to Liverpool easily. Whether you want fast, cheap or something entirely different, our travel experts have collected everything you need to know so you can find the best option from Dublin to Liverpool.

FAQs
You can travel between Dublin and Liverpool by flight.
The cheapest way to travel from Dublin to Liverpool is a flight with an average price of $21 (€17).
The fastest way to travel from Dublin to Liverpool is by flight with an average journey time of 55m.
The distance from Dublin to Liverpool is approximately 134 miles (217 km).
The average frequency per day from Dublin to Liverpool is:
  • Around 6 flights per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Dublin and Liverpool as scheduled services by flight can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Dublin to Liverpool:
  • Flights mostly depart from Dublin Airport and arrive in Liverpool John Lennon Airport.
  • Buses mostly depart from Dublin, Busáras and arrive in Liverpool, One Bus Station, Canning Place.
  • Ferries mostly depart from Port of Belfast and arrive in Liverpool (Port of Birkenhead).
